Product details

640-channel capacitive touch controller for large-format panels

The Microchip ATMXT640UD-CCUR001 is a 640-channel MaxTouch UD series touchscreen controller for 2-wire capacitive touch sensors — the channel count scales to cover displays up to about 15–17 inches depending on sensor pitch and routing, making it a fit for industrial HMIs, point-of-sale terminals, and medical touch interfaces that need multi-touch without a bezel overlay. It communicates over I²C or SPI, giving the host MCU a choice between a two-wire bus at lower data rates or a four-wire bus for faster report rates — SPI is the usual pick when the touch controller shares the bus with other peripherals and the host needs sub-10 ms latency on touch reports.

Supply rails and temperature range for embedded integration

The ATMXT640UD-CCUR001 runs from a dual-supply scheme: a 1.71 V to 3.47 V core rail and a separate 3.14 V to 3.47 V I/O rail — the core voltage lets it interface directly with 1.8 V logic MCUs, while the I/O rail matches 3.3 V peripheral buses without a level shifter. Supply current is 40 mA typical — modest for a 640-channel controller scanning a full panel at a 100–120 Hz report rate, and low enough that a standard 3.3 V LDO with 150 mA rating has headroom for the controller plus the sensor drive.
